理解 MySQL 中模式和数据库的区别
在 MySQL 数据库管理领域,“模式”和“模式”的概念数据库”经常出现,导致人们对它们之间的关系和差异产生疑问。本文深入探讨了这两个术语之间的区别,阐明了它们在 MySQL 上下文中的用法。
MySQL 中的架构和数据库
与 SQL 中的层次关系相反服务器中的数据库是模式的高级容器,MySQL 数据库管理系统将这些术语视为同义词。在 MySQL 中,“模式”本质上等同于“数据库”,无论是物理上还是功能上。因此,在 MySQL SQL 语法中使用“CREATE SCHEMA”而不是“CREATE DATABASE”是可以互换的。
混乱的起源
混乱可能源于不同的这些术语在各种数据库管理系统中的解释。例如,在 Oracle 数据库中,模式仅代表数据库的一部分,包括特定用户拥有的表和对象。然而,在 MySQL 中,这种区别并不适用。
以上是MySQL 中的架构和数据库有什么区别?的详细内容。更多信息请关注PHP中文网其他相关文章!